How’s he acting? It might br a deformity of the nostrils, but they are very resilient at this age. Some vitamins like nutri drench should help. Their head can swell if they take longer to hatch. Monitor him well but he looks good otherwise? Keep us posted.
What kind of geese are they? Chinese have the knobs above their bills.
